What defines a DOT specification fire extinguisher cylinder?

Explanation:
A DOT specification fire extinguisher cylinder is clearly defined by being stamped with a specification number. This stamping indicates that the cylinder has been manufactured in accordance with the standards and regulations set forth by the Department of Transportation (DOT). These standards ensure safety, performance, and structural integrity for the cylinders used in transporting and storing compressed gases, which includes the extinguishing agents in fire extinguishers. Having a specification number means the cylinder has undergone the necessary testing and quality assurance processes, confirming that it can safely handle the pressures and conditions for which it is designed. This includes guidelines surrounding materials, manufacturing processes, testing standards, and periodic inspections. Being marked with a specification number also helps in identifying the cylinder’s compliance with established safety standards, making it reliable for use in emergency situations. In contrast, cylinders that lack this specification may not meet safety standards, which makes the presence of a specification number a vital feature for ensuring the reliability and safety of fire extinguishers.
